Roofing evaluation services involve a comprehensive inspection of a property's roof to assess its overall condition. These evaluations typ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as missing or damaged shingles, leaks, or areas of wear. Inspectors also evaluate the structural integrity of the roofing system, including the underlying decking and support structures. The goal is to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ities that could lead to more significant problems if left unaddressed.
This service helps property owners address a variety of roofing concerns before they develop into costly repairs or replacements. It is particularly useful for detecting leaks, water intrusion, or damage caused by severe weather events. Roofing evaluations can also identify areas where the roof may be nearing the end of its lifespan, enabling proactive maintenance or replacement planning. The overview below groups typical Roofing Evaluation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Edgewater,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Assessment Fees - Roofing evaluation services typically range from $100 to $300 for a comprehensive inspection. These costs may vary based on the size of the roof and the complexity of the assessment.
Inspection Costs - Detailed roof inspections often cost between $150 and $400, with higher prices for larger or more difficult-to-access roofs in areas like Edgewater, MD.
Estimate Expenses - Providers may charge between $200 and $500 for an evaluation that includes detailed reports and recommendations for repairs or replacements.
Consultation Fees - Initial consultation or evaluation services usually fall within the $100 to $250 range, depending on the scope and depth of the assessment required by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ing evaluation? A roofing evaluation involves a professional inspection to assess the condition of a roof, identifying potential issues or damage.
How often should a roofing evaluation be performed? It is recommended to have a roofing evaluation conducted periodically, especially after severe weather or if signs of damage are present.
What signs indicate a need for a roofing evaluation?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, water stains, or sagging areas can suggest the need for an evaluation.
What does a roofing evaluation typically include? The process usually involves a visual inspection of the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and attic space if accessible.
How can a roofing evaluation benefit property owners? A professional assessment can help detect issues early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the roof’s lifespan.
